Honey Sesame Seed Candy Ingredients

• This honey sesame seed candy is not only simple to make but also incredibly satisfying!

For the Candy

  • Honey or Maple Syrup – This is the primary sweetener; choose maple syrup for a vegan twist!
  • Raw Sesame Seeds – These provide the main structure and a delightful crunch; toasting enhances their nutty flavor.

Optional Additions

  • Vanilla Extract – A splash of this adds depth and flavor to your candy.
  • Sea Salt – Just a pinch can balance the sweetness; adjust according to your taste.
  • Cinnamon – Consider this for a warm, spicy note; it’s entirely optional but delightful!

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for honey sesame seed candy

Step 1: Prepare Baking Sheet
Start by lining a baking sheet with parchment paper and lightly greasing it with cooking spray or a little oil to prevent sticking. This will serve as the foundation for your honey sesame seed candy. Make sure to smooth out any wrinkles in the parchment; a flat surface ensures even cooling.

Step 2: Toast Sesame Seeds
In a skillet over medium heat, add the raw sesame seeds. Toast them for 2–3 minutes, stirring frequently until they become golden and fragrant. Keep a close eye on them to avoid burning, as they will darken quickly. Once toasted, remove the skillet from heat and set it aside to cool briefly.

Step 3: Combine Ingredients
Return the skillet to the burner and add honey or maple syrup, allowing it to bubble gently. Cook the mixture for 3–4 minutes while stirring occasionally, allowing it to thicken slightly. You’ll notice a change in texture as it starts to become sticky; this is essential for forming your candy.

Step 4: Cook Further
Reduce the heat to low and continue stirring the syrup mixture for an additional 1–3 minutes. You’re looking for a thick, sticky consistency that coats the back of a spoon. This step is crucial for achieving the right texture in your honey sesame seed candy, so be sure not to rush it.

Step 5: Cool and Set
Carefully pour the thick mixture onto your prepared baking sheet, spreading it evenly with a spatula to about 1 inch thick. Allow the candy to cool at room temperature for a short while or pop it in the refrigerator to firm up completely, which should take a few hours. This cooling step will help it set perfectly for slicing later.

Storage Tips for Honey Sesame Seed Candy

Room Temperature: Store your honey sesame seed candy in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 1 month. Keep it in a cool, dry place to maintain its freshness.

Fridge: If you prefer a chewier texture, you can refrigerate the candy. Just ensure it’s in an airtight container to prevent it from drying out.

Freezer: For long-term storage, freeze the candy for up to 1 year. Wrap each piece tightly in plastic wrap, then place them in an airtight freezer bag to avoid freezer burn.

What should I do if my candy turns out too sticky?
If your honey sesame seed candy is excessively sticky, it likely didn’t cook long enough for the mixture to thicken properly. Make sure to stir continuously while it bubbles and cook until it consistently coats the back of a spoon. If it has already cooled, try returning it to heat and cooking a bit longer until it thickens.

Guilt-Free Honey Sesame Seed Candy in Just 15 Minutes

This honey sesame seed candy is a quick, guilt-free treat perfect for satisfying your sweet tooth in under 15 minutes.
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Cooling Time 1 hour
Total Time 1 hour 15 minutes
Servings: 12 pieces
Course: Dessert
Cuisine: Vegan
Calories: 100

Ingredients
  

For the Candy
  • 1 cup Honey or Maple Syrup Choose maple syrup for a vegan option.
  • 1 cup Raw Sesame Seeds Toast for enhanced flavor.
Optional Additions
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la Extract Adds flavor.
  • 1 pinch Sea Salt Balances sweetness.
  • 1 teaspoon Cinnamon Optional for warmth.

Equipment

  • Skillet
  • Baking Sheet
  • Parchment Paper
  • Spatula

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. Prepare Baking Sheet: Line a baking sheet with parchment paper and lightly grease it with cooking spray or oil.
  2. Toast Sesame Seeds: In a skillet over medium heat, toast raw sesame seeds for 2–3 minutes, stirring frequently until golden and fragrant.
  3. Combine Ingredients: Add honey or maple syrup to the skillet and let it bubble gently, cooking for 3–4 minutes while stirring.
  4. Cook Further: Reduce heat to low and stir for an additional 1–3 minutes until the mixture reaches a thick, sticky consistency.
  5. Cool and Set: Pour the mixture onto the prepared baking sheet and spread it evenly, allowing it to cool at room temperature or refrigerate to firm up.
